                  4-STAR PHOENIX -1 over Minnesota - When you are looking at the two worst teams in a conference, home court advantage is huge. We don't understand why Vegas would think Minnesota would have the edge in a neutral site matchup between these teams and are inclined to grab the Suns here.
                  Minnesota lost at home Sunday to Golden State, 100-99. It was a late loss as they led nearly the entire game. The Timberwolves are 0-10 ATS (-5.8 ppg) since January 02, 2008 as a dog with at most one day of rest off a loss in which they led at the end of each of the first three quarters.
                  Phoenix fell to San Antonio at home Sunday, 97-87. Of their 30 baskets in that game, 24 were assisted. The Suns are 11-0 ATS (8.4 ppg) since November 08, 2009 as a favorite with at least one day of rest after a game in which more than 70% of their baskets were assisted.
                  However, Phoenix was also riddled with 20 turnovers. The Suns are 7-0-1 ATS (10.9 ppg) since March 22, 2008 as a home favorite with at least one day of rest after a game in which they had at least five more turnovers than their season-to-date average.
                  They did a nice job getting to the foul line and went 24-of-33 there. The Suns are 6-0-1 ATS (8.2 ppg) since April 29, 2010 after a game at home in which they scored more than 25% of their points from the free throw line.
                  SPORTSBOOK BREAKERS PREDICTION: PHOENIX 103, Minnesota 94
                  4-STAR Cleveland and Chicago Under 190.5 - Poor shooting like Chicago's is one thing, but it really does not bode well when a team plays at a slow pace to begin with. Don't expect Chicago's poor shooting to encourage them to play for any more possessions in what should amount to a low scoring game.
                  Chicago shot just 29% from the field in a 102-72 loss to Oklahoma City Sunday. The Bulls are 0-8 OU (-13.6 ppg) since February 20, 2007 at home with at least one day of rest after a double digit road loss in which they shot less than 40% from the field.
                  Joakim Noah was one offender. He went just 2-of-9 from the field. The Bulls are 0-12 OU (-14.5 ppg) since March 22, 2008 at home with at least a day of rest after a loss in which Joakim Noah shot worse than 33% from the field.
                  Noah finished with eight points and nine rebounds. The Bulls are 0-9 OU (-10.9 ppg) since April 04, 2009 at home with at least a day of rest after a loss on the road in which Joakim Noah had more rebounds than points.
                  Carlos Boozer scored just two points in 24 minutes. He also had three turnovers and just one assist. The Bulls are 0-6 OU (-14.2 ppg) since April 21, 2012 at home after a loss in which Carlos Boozer had more turnovers than assists.
                  Cleveland gave Miami a run but fell Sunday night, 109-105. They were led by Dion Waiters with 26 points as Kyrie Irving had 17. The Cavaliers are 0-10 OU (-11.1 ppg) since March 25, 2012 with at least a day of rest after a loss on the road in which Kyrie Irving was not the Cavaliers' high scorer.
                  Alonzo Gee had nine points in 40 minutes, taking just seven shots in the game. The Cavaliers are 0-8 OU (-12.2 ppg) since November 17, 2012 with at least a day of rest after a loss on the road in which Alonzo Gee took fewer than 10 shots.
                  When these teams met last in January, Chicago won 118-92. They held a 47-31 rebounding edge in that game. The Cavaliers are 0-8 OU (-10.6 ppg) since February 27, 2011 when seeking revenge for a road loss in which they were out-rebounded by double-digits.
                  SPORTSBOOK BREAKERS PREDICTION: Cleveland 91, CHICAGO 88
                  4-STAR INDIANA -8 over Golden State - Golden State has revived itself in the last three games, but that has mainly come at home. Their performances against decent or better teams on the road recently have still been quite poor. Indiana's size and defensive focus is a tough matchup for Golden State and we didn't see it going well for them today.
                  Golden State trailed nearly the entire way before pulling off a 100-99 win in Minnesota Sunday. They overcame 22 turnovers in the win. The Warriors are 0-9 ATS (-12.6 ppg) since March 12, 2004 as a road dog with at least one day of rest after a game on the road in which they had at least five more turnovers than their season-to-date average.
                  However, they've been pushing their starters recently, David Lee in particular who played 41 minutes in that game. The Warriors are 0-6 ATS (-9.1 ppg) since December 29, 2010 on the road after David Lee played more than 40 minutes the last two.
                  Indiana has won four straight games. They defeated Detroit on the road Saturday, 90-72. The Pacers are 9-0-1 ATS (11.7 ppg) since January 04, 2005 as a home favorite with two or more days of rest when they held their opponent to fewer than 85 points in their last game.
                  Detroit was held to just 34% shooting in that game. The Pacers are 6-0 ATS (16.2 ppg) since January 04, 2005 as a home favorite with two or more days of rest after a game on the road in which they allowed less than 40% from the field.
                  Roy Hibbert had 10 points in the win but Indiana was led by George Hill with 17. The Pacers are 9-0-1 ATS (8.8 ppg) since February 28, 2012 at home after a win on the road in which Roy Hibbert was not the Pacers' high scorer.
                  Working Danny Granger back into the fold, he struggled in the game but was able to play 19 minutes. The Pacers are 6-0 ATS (10.2 ppg) since November 07, 2006 at home with at least a day of rest after a win on the road in which Danny Granger played fewer than 30 minutes. SPORTSBOOK BREAKERS PREDICTION: INDIANA 106, Golden State 91
